GOVERNOR HUBBARD, LUCIUS F.:

An Inventory of His Gubernatorial Records

Government Records

Expand/CollapseOVERVIEW

Creator: Minnesota. Governor (1882-1887 : Hubbard).
Title: Records of Governor Lucius F. Hubbard,
Dates:1882-1891 (bulk 1882-1887).
Abstract:Assorted files on public policy matters, including materials relating to State Capitol construction, public lands, pardons, applications for and appointments to office, Ojibwe Indian affairs, World's Industrial and Cotton Centennial Exposition in New Orleans, and tornadoes ("cyclones") in the St. Cloud and Sauk Rapids vicinity (1886). Some materials date from the administrations of Andrew R. McGill and William R. Merriam.
Quantity:9.0 cubic feet (8 boxes and 2 partial boxes).
